Acknowledging ESWT Treatment for ED

Extracorporeal Shock Wave Therapy (ESWT) is a non-invasive procedure that uses low-intensity shock waves to enhance blood flow, promoting tissue regeneration and supporting the body’s natural healing processes. While ESWT has been used in various medical fields, its application in treating erectile dysfunction has garnered considerable interest.

Key Benefits of ESWT for ED

Improved Blood Flow: ESWT has been shown to stimulate the growth of new blood vessels in the penis, leading to enhanced blood circulation, which is crucial for achieving and maintaining an erection.

Non-Invasive Nature: Unlike surgical interventions, ESWT is non-invasive, meaning that it does not involve incisions or the use of needles. This can lead to reduced recovery time and minimal discomfort for the patient.

Long-Term Effects: Some studies suggest that the benefits of ESWT treatment for ED can be long-lasting, providing sustained improvements in erectile function over time.

The ESWT Procedure

Duration and Frequency: ESWT sessions typically last between 15 to 20 minutes, and multiple sessions may be required to achieve optimal results. The frequency of treatments will be determined by your healthcare provider based on your specific needs.

Comfort and Safety: During the ESWT procedure, the shock waves are delivered to targeted areas of the penis, with the process designed to be comfortable and safe for the patient. Most individuals tolerate the treatment well and experience minimal to no side effects.

Post-Treatment Care and Expectations

Recovery Period: Following ESWT sessions, there is usually no downtime, allowing you to resume your daily activities immediately. Your healthcare provider will offer guidance on post-treatment care to optimize the benefits of the therapy.

Patient Experience: While individual responses to ESWT may vary, many men report positive outcomes, including improved erectile function and overall sexual satisfaction.
